Meghan Markle talks early Prince Harry romance — including who said ‘I love you’



With love, Prince Harry.

Meghan Markle gave a rare glimpse into her early days with her husband, Prince Harry, on Tuesday’s Season 2 premiere of her Netflix show.

When “With Love, Meghan” guest Tan France asked the Duchess of Sussex whether she or Harry, 40, said “I love you first,” Markle confirmed that “he told” her.

“She’s still got it!” the “Suits” alum, 44, quipped.

Markle noted that she knew she loved the Duke of Sussex on their third date camping in Botswana.

“You really get to know somebody when you’re in a little tent together and there’s like, ‘What is that outside the tent?’” she recalled with a laugh. “’That’s an elephant.’ ‘Are we gonna be safe?’ ‘Yeah, you’re safe.’ ‘OK.’”

In addition to her conversation with the “Queer Eye” alum, Markle opened up about the “terrible” meal she made before Harry proposed to her in 2017.

“I was still having a lot of challenges with the conversion of Celsius and Fahrenheit,” the former actress explained. “I made a horrible chicken that night.

“So the point is, you can make a terrible chicken, and someone is still going to appreciate the thought,” she continued.

Elsewhere in the episodes, Markle shared rare anecdotes about Harry, who did not make a cameo in the show like he did the first time around.

The couple served fried chicken and other “late-night bites” after their May 2018 wedding, the “Deal or No Deal” alum shared with chef Clare Smyth.

For their first anniversary, the duo celebrated in a “beautiful little old chapel.”

The pair welcomed son Archie, now 6, in May 2019, followed by daughter Lilibet, now 4, in June 2021.

Markle joked about having a “secret” third child while talking to Chrissy Teigen, saying it would have been “impressive” to keep that under wraps.

The second season of “With Love, Meghan” began streaming on Netflix Tuesday.
